Q: Is 4,463,260 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,463,260 is a composite number.

Why is 4,463,260 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,463,260 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 41 82 164 205 410 820 5,443 10,886 21,772 27,215 54,430 108,860 223,163 446,326 892,652 1,115,815 2,231,630 and 4,463,260, with no remainder.

Since 4,463,260 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,463,260, it is a composite number.
